TRELLO_GET_BOARDS_MEMBERSHIPS_BY_ID_BOARD_BY_ID_MEMBERSHIP
Retrieves a specific membership on a Trello board by its ID, optionally including member details.

| Parameter | Type |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
member | string | — | Set to 'true' to return the full member object. If 'false' or not provided, Trello's default for member details (typically minimal) applies. |
idBoard | string | — | The ID of the Trello board. |
idMembership | string | — | The ID of the membership to retrieve. |
member_fields | string | — | Comma-separated list of member fields to return if 'member' is 'true' (e.g., avatarHash,fullName), or 'all'. Valid fields: avatarHash, bio, bioData, confirmed, |

Why TRELLO_GET_BOARDS_MEMBERSHIPS_BY_ID_BOARD_BY_ID_MEMBERSHIP is rated Low
This tool retrieves board membership data by ID. It is a read operation with no side effects. The blast radius of misuse is minimal—an agent could only access membership details already available through normal Trello operations, without modifying board state or triggering financial/destructive actions.
From the tool's definition Tool name contains GET and description states "Retrieves a specific membership". The operation is read-only: it fetches membership information without modifying, deleting, or executing any operations.
